Course Description

This three- to six-hour eLearning course is designed to give learners an overview of the new features and functionality enhancements in Crystal Reports 2008. The new features and functionality improvements include advanced information visualization, improved end-user report viewing experience, enhanced report designer productivity, new flexible deployment options, and flexible application integration as well as the changes to certain components of Crystal Reports.

The business benefit of this course is that learners will be able to describe and use the new features of Crystal Reports 2008.



Course Audience
The target audience for this course is learners who want to understand the new features and functionality enhancements of Crystal Reports 2008.



Course Topics

Lesson #1: Advanced Information Visualization

  • Describe and use Adobe Flash in Crystal reports
  • Describe the integration with Xcelsius
  • Describe the integration with Adobe Flex applications


Lesson #2: Improved Report Viewing Experience

  • Describe and use interactive parameters
  • Describe how multilingual support affects report design
  • Describe the prompting improvements
  • Describe the viewer improvements
  • Describe how Report Designer Add-ins work
  • Describe and use the set data source location feature for universes
  • Describe the web pagination improvements


Lesson #3: Improved Report Designer Productivity

  • Describe the added functionality when using barcodes in Crystal Reports
  • Describe and use calculated members in a crosstab
  • Describe the improvements in hyperlinking
  • Describe and use sort controls


Lesson #4: Flexible Deployment Options

  • Describe how to save a report to crystalreports.com
  • Describe and use XML exporting
  • Describe the advanced report publishing options


Lesson #5: Flexible Application Integration

  • Describe how Salesforce.com data is integrated with Crystal Reports 2008
  • Describe and use web services


Lesson #6: Changes to Crystal Reports 2008 Components
  • Describe what's different in Crystal Reports 2008 from the previous lesson
